The sermon focuses on spiritual growth in the Christian faith, emphasizing that true belief involves more than superficial acceptance. It explores the concept of "traction" as the Holy Spirit's ability to create movement and momentum in one's life. The message challenges listeners to examine the depth of their faith, distinguishing between shallow belief, which departs when faced with hard truths, and genuine faith rooted in a transformative relationship with Jesus. The speaker identifies three reasons for seeking growth: love for God, the purpose of sharing Christ with others, and the power of the Holy Spirit. Listeners are encouraged to actively pursue movement in knowing God, understanding their identity in Christ, connecting with the Christian community, and participating in God's mission.
